So what genius idea did I come up with to make these boring unfrosted Pop-Tarts taste better? I channeled my inner Elvis Presley, whipped up a banana glaze for them and topped them with that and some bacon! Yep, Elvis Pop-Tarts!

So what should you do if you randomly come upon unfrosted peanut butter flavored Pop-Tarts? I’ll tell you exactly what you should do, you should combine 1/2 a banana, a tablespoon butter, 1 1/2 cups powdered sugar and 1/2 teaspoon vanilla, mix it up real nice like, frost those suckers with your new banana glaze and then top them with bacon.
